Well... the media has taken the drab name of w32sober.X@mm or w32sober.x or w32sober.y, W32/Sober.AD-mm or any of those other drab names that we've been looking at the last week and dubbed the latest big virus, the FBI/CIA virus.... and it's gotten a lot of press the last few days. I suspect as people head back to work from Thanksgiving, we may see a slight bump in traffic. (Bringing infected laptops into the network maybe? or just home/office users getting back to work...)
